Frequently asked questions about bed and breakfast in Phillip Island

  • Are there any famous festivals on Phillip Island, Australia?

    Phillip Island hosts several events throughout the year. The most well-known is probably the Grand Prix Motorcycle racing at the Phillip Island Grand Prix Circuit. There's also the Penguin Parade, although that's a nightly event rather than a festival in the traditional sense.

  • Which local specialties should not be missed on Phillip Island, Australia?

    Seafood is definitely a highlight. Many restaurants source fresh catches from the surrounding waters. Look for local oysters, mussels, and freshly caught fish. You'll also find some great wineries on the island producing excellent cool-climate wines.

  • What are some unique or less touristy places to visit on Phillip Island, Australia?

    Away from the main tourist areas, explore the backroads and discover hidden beaches like Smiths Beach or Rhyll Inlet. The Cape Woolamai Lighthouse offers stunning coastal views, and the rugged terrain around it is less crowded than the penguin parade area. A visit to the Churchill Island Heritage Farm provides a glimpse into the island's history.

  • What kinds of terrain and natural landscapes does Phillip Island, Australia offer?

    Phillip Island boasts diverse landscapes. There are beautiful sandy beaches, dramatic coastal cliffs, rolling farmland, and the serene wetlands of Rhyll Inlet. The island's interior features eucalyptus forests and grassy plains.

  • Are there family-friendly hiking trails on Phillip Island, Australia?

    Yes, there are several. The coastal tracks around Cape Woolamai are relatively easy and offer stunning ocean views. The trails around the Churchill Island Heritage Farm are also suitable for families, with shorter, gentler paths through the bushland and farmlands. Always check trail conditions before you go.

  • What is the perfect week-long itinerary for Phillip Island, Australia?

    A week allows for a relaxed pace. Day 1: Arrive and explore Cowes. Day 2: Penguin Parade and Nobbies Centre. Day 3: Churchill Island Heritage Farm and a winery. Day 4: Coastal walk to Cape Woolamai. Day 5: Explore Smiths Beach and Rhyll Inlet. Day 6: Phillip Island Grand Prix Circuit (if in season). Day 7: Relax and depart. This is just a suggestion, adapt it to your interests.
